google: The hypothesis is falsifiable but overly broad. While random-key optimizers *can* be applied (as shown in one paper), the papers don't strongly support that they *can find optimal* parameters in financial markets, especially given market complexity and noise.
openai: It’s loosely falsifiable in a toy setting but “find optimal parameters” in real financial markets is underspecified (optimal under what objective, regime, and constraints) and generally unattainable with no-free-lunch and nonstationarity issues; the cited papers largely concern optimizer efficien...
